Description

This course provides knowledge and application of the collection and use of academic and behavioral data for the educational diagnosis, assessment and evaluation of individuals with disabilities. Discussion includes: norm-referenced instruments, criterion-referenced instruments, observation assessment, behavioral rating instruments and others. The application of assessment results to individualized program development and management. A minumum of 10 hours of classroom observation/experience is required.. Prerequisites: EDU 110, EDU 304, EDU 467, and admittance to the Teacher Education Program.
